Air pollution causes 2 million premature deaths worldwide per year.
Direct causes of air pollution related deaths include aggravated asthma, bronchitis, emphysema, lung and heart diseases, and other respiratory allergies. The US EPA estimates that a proposed set of changes in diesel engine technology and oil recycling (Tier 2) could result in 12,000 fewer premature mortalities, 15,000 fewer heart attacks, 6000 fewer emergency room visits by children with asthma, and 8900 fewer respiratory-related hospital admissions each year in the United States.

Currently, most waste oil collection services use the oil they collect as an animal feed additive. While this is utilizing something normally considered a waste product, it isn’t being put to its most productive use and isn’t contributing to the wellbeing of our communities’ food supply or air quality.
